Abstract
- This article examines the intersections between popular music studies, ethnomusicology, and curricular reform in college and university music programs in North America and the United Kingdom. Scrutinized through the lens of the positioning of Western popular music studies in ethnomusicology, it will be argued that ethnomusicology itself must undergo reform before being held up as a model to emulate for educational transformation.
